Technical Specifications

Electrical Characteristics

Parameter Specification
Primary Voltage Rating 0.6/1kV (Uo/U)
Maximum System Voltage 1.2kV (Um)
DC Test Voltage 1.8kV (core-earth/core-core)
AC Test Voltage 4kV
Frequency Rating 50Hz AC systems

Temperature Performance

Operating Condition Temperature Range
Flexible Installation +5°C to +90°C
Fixed Installation -35°C to +90°C
Short Circuit Maximum +250°C (5 seconds max)

Installation Parameters

Cable Type Minimum Bend Radius
Single Core Configuration 15 × overall diameter
Multi Core Configuration 12 × overall diameter

Cable Architecture

N2XBY Cable Construction

N2XBY Cable Construction

Layer-by-Layer Construction

  1. Core Conductor: High-quality copper construction
    • Class 1: Solid conductor option
    • Class 2: Stranded conductor option
  2. Primary Insulation: Cross-linked polyethylene (XLPE) for superior electrical performance
  3. Cable Core Assembly:
    • Non-hygroscopic filler material
    • Non-hygroscopic binder tape system
  4. Inner Protection: Polyvinyl chloride (PVC) inner sheath
  5. Mechanical Armor: Double galvanized steel tape providing robust protection
  6. Outer Protection: Durable PVC outer sheath for environmental resistance

Industrial Applications

Primary Use Cases

  • Industrial Power Distribution: Main power feeds for manufacturing facilities
  • Underground Infrastructure: Tunnel installations and buried power lines
  • Fixed Industrial Equipment: Permanent power connections for heavy machinery
  • Harsh Environment Power: Applications requiring superior mechanical protection

Installation Environments

  • Underground cable tunnels and ducts
  • Industrial facilities with mechanical hazards
  • Direct burial applications
  • Cable tray installations in industrial settings
  • Areas requiring rodent and impact protection

Compliance & Standards

International Standards Adherence

  • IEC 60228: Conductor specifications and requirements
  • IEC 60502-1: Power cable standards for 1kV-30kV applications, specifically covering 1kV and 3kV rated cables with extruded insulation systems
